  • Ottoman–Mamluk War (1516–17) [began AUGUST 24, five hundred years ago]

    08/26/2016 6:24:55 PM PDT · by Enchante · 11 replies
    Wikipedia ^ | July 19, 2016 | Wikipedia
    Operations in the Levant (1516) The Ottomans first captured the city of Diyarbekir in southeastern Anatolia.[2] The Battle of Marj Dabiq (24 August 1516) was decisive, in which the Mamluk ruler Kansuh al-Ghuri was killed.[2] The Ottomans apparently outnumbered the Mamluks by a factor of 3 to 1.[6] Syria fell under the rule of the Ottomans with this single battle.[6] The Battle of Yaunis Khan occurred near Gaza (1516) and was again a defeat for the Mamluks.

  • Islamic State leader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i addresses Muslims in Mosul

    07/05/2014 6:35:49 PM PDT · by MinorityRepublican · 7 replies
    The Telegraph ^ | July 5, 2014 | Hannah Strange
    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, the leader of the Islamic State, emerged from the shadows to lead Friday prayers at Mosul’s Great Mosque, calling on the world’s Muslims to “obey” him as the head of the caliphate declared by the Sunni jihadist group. The notoriously secretive jihadi, who has never before been seen in public, chose the first Friday prayer service of Ramadan to make an audacious display of power in the city that the Sunni Islamists have now controlled for three weeks.   •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, the jihadist 'caliph'

    07/05/2014 10:15:07 AM PDT · by NormsRevenge · 23 replies
    Yahoo! News ^ | 7/5/14 | AFP
    Baghdad (AFP) -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i, the enigmatic self-proclaimed "caliph" of a state straddling Iraq and Syria, is increasingly seen as more powerful than Al-Qaeda's chief. The leader of the powerful Islamic State (IS) militant group was on June 29 declared "caliph" in an attempt to revive a system of rule that ended nearly 100 years ago with the fall of the Ottoman Empire. In a video posted online on Saturday, purportedly the first known footage of Baghdadi, he ordered Muslims to obey him during a Ramadan sermon delivered at a mosque in the northern militant-held Iraqi city of Mosul.
